In-Depth Review
Kickstand Case
Wednesday, February 15th, 2006 at 11:45 AM - by Misha Sakellaropoulo
For people accustomed to vegging out in front the television, having to hold on to about five ounces for an extended period of time in order to watch videos on their 5G iPod at a comfortable angle is simply unacceptable. Fortunately, Belkin has ceased upon this shortcoming and developed the Kickstand, a handsome leather case that can bend apart to prop your iPod up at a nice angle, perfect for tray tables on airplanes or anywhere else.
![]() Belkin Kickstand Case for 5G iPod |
The Kickstand is crafted from soft leather and compared to other leather cases features good stitching and cut-outs for the screen and click wheel. Each of the former are protected by pieces of plastic that are attached to the case, offering excellent protection to the screen and click wheel but at the expense of minor losses to clarity and control.

Kickstand cracked open
Unlike most cases, the iPod loads into the Kickstand from the bottom with a small hook and fabric loop keeping things together. In order to remove the iPod or convert the case to stand mode you must undo this hook, which isn't the handiest design but it's certainly effective. Attached to the fabric loop is a button clasp that snaps to the case and keeps it secure when set to stand mode. The Kickstand's design prevents a belt clip from being used with the case so Belkin includes a caribiner instead.


The Bottom Line
If you find yourself watching videos on your iPod frequently, the Kickstand is your ideal case companion. The quality is sound, the price is reasonable, and the convenience unquestionable.
The Kickstand is available in black or white from Belkin, but Amazon lists a pink version for only $20.99 as well.
Just The Facts
Pros:convenient design, good materials and construction
Cons:forget about using dock accessories with the case
